THE VALUES OF YOUTH

-- COMPARING THE VIEWS OF 12 - 24 YEAR OLDS IN 11 COUNTRIES ON THEMSELVES AND WHAT'S IMPORTANT -- -- "KEEPING YOUR WORD" (95%), "HELPING OTHERS" (89%), "WORKING HARD" (84%) ARE MOST IMPORTANT VALUES TO THE WORLD'S YOUTH -- -- TRADITIONAL VALUES PREFERRED TO TRADITIONAL INSTITUTIONS - "LIFELONG PARTNER" (77%) versus "GETTING MARRIED" (56%) - "GOING TO CHURCH" (41%) versus "RESISTING TEMPTATION" (71%) --


In March 1999, a total of 4,380 interviews were conducted with youth between the ages of 12 and 24 in Argentina, Australia, France, Germany, Italy, Japan, South Korea, Spain, UK, US, and Canada by the Angus Reid Group for CNN International.

The sample size for each country is 300, except for Canada. Canadian youth data were collected using the Angus Reid Group's omnibus research vehicle "Youthscape", which sampled over 1300 Canadian youths. The margin of error for a sample of 300 is plus or minus 5.7%, nineteen times out of twenty. The margin of error for the Canadian data is plus or minus 2.7%, nineteen times out of twenty.
